Understanding Stance and Neck Pain
When it concerns neck discomfort, understanding the function of posture is critical. Your position substantially impacts the placement of your spine and the overall health and wellness of your neck. When you rest or stand appropriately, your body preserves an all-natural curve, which can protect against unnecessary pressure on your neck muscles.
You mightn't recognize it, but just how you position your head, shoulders, and back can either relieve or worsen discomfort. When you're hunched over a computer system or looking down at your phone, you're most likely placing extreme pressure on your neck. This forward head position can lead to muscle stress and pain.
You need to be mindful of exactly how your body straightens throughout the day and make changes as needed. Easy practices can help enhance your pose. For instance, ensure your workstation is ergonomically established, allowing your monitor to be at eye level.
When you're resting, attempt to keep your feet flat on the ground and your back straight. On a regular basis check in with your position and make small modifications to stay clear of long-term discomfort. By focusing on great posture, you can considerably reduce your threat of neck discomfort and preserve a much more comfy, healthy and balanced lifestyle.
Common Pose Mistakes
Lots of people unconsciously make typical position errors that can lead to neck pain and discomfort. One of the most regular mistakes is slumping over while sitting or standing. When you stoop your shoulders or lean onward, you strain your neck muscles, creating tension that can intensify into pain.
Another error is overlooking at your gadgets for extensive periods. Whether you're scrolling on your phone or operating at a computer system, turning your head downward places additional pressure on your neck.
Furthermore, you could find yourself craning your neck to get a much better sight, specifically in jampacked rooms or during conferences. This forward head pose can add to chronic neck discomfort with time.
Poor ergonomic configurations also come into play. If your workstation isn't lined up correctly, you could be pushed into unnatural positions that can set off discomfort.

Chiropractic Care Tips for Improvement
Improving your posture and decreasing neck discomfort can be substantially assisted by chiropractic care. You need to also include particular workouts into your routine. Reinforcing your neck and upper back muscle mass can boost your pose. Basic exercises like chin tucks and shoulder blade presses can make a big difference.
Furthermore, stretching your neck and top back can eliminate tightness that adds to pain.
Take note of your work area. Guarantee your computer system display is at eye level, and your chair supports your lower back. When resting, keep your feet level on the floor and your shoulders loosened up.
Finally, be mindful of your behaviors. If you invest a great deal of time on your phone, hold it at eye level rather than flexing your neck down.
